Just as this publication captures in photos the year at H-L, Mr. Racette's Mass Media II Class captures on vid- eo tape happenings in and about schools from being in the classroom, to filming concerts, special assemblies and sports. In the Spring of '86 they also produced a new program of hu- man interest stories once a week which was shown on Cable TV 10 to the three surrounding towns; Lake Luzerne, Hadley, and Cornith. Several times during the school year students went one step farther with television in that they went to WRGB in Schenectady to participate in Student Spectrum a student news program. Members of the community were invited to come to Hadley Luzerne and serve as volunteers in the class- room. This consisted of being an aide to the teachers in many ways. The volunteers benefited as much as the children in that they saw the activities going on in the various classes and were able to appreciate the work load the teachers carried in educating our children. OUR SENIOR TRIP IT'S UP, UP AND AWAY as Sixth Graders at the Stuart M. Townsend Middle School design, build and then fire off their rockets as part of a Science unit. One of the more popular activities in the Fall, the launching always attracts not only the builders, but other students and par- ents. A BALLOON RELEASE by elementary students took place October 23rd on Drug Awareness Day. The Hadley Luzerne Lioness Club purchased the balloons which were inflated by S.A.D.D. Chapter members and distributed to all the elementary students. Some stu- dents attached name address cards so that they might get a re- sponse from the finder of the bal- loon. All balloons were released at 2 pm on the ball field near the audi- torium. ROCK-A-THON Over $6800 was raised from the rock-a-thon as about 100 high school students brought in their own rocking chairs and plenty of support material to carry them through 15 hours. Monies raised went towards a scholar- ship fund. A VISIT TO THE CEMETARY is part of the English 10 writing assignments. Students look over the various tombstones, find a name and whatever information catches their fancy and then create their own composition about someone from the combination of imagination and information obtained.
